What problem does it solve?

scikit-bio provides a comprehensive Python toolkit for working with biological data, enabling researchers to manipulate sequences, alignments, and phylogenies in a unified workflow.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Sequence data handling (read/write FASTA/FASTQ, GenBank)
  • Alignment, phylogenetic tree construction, and diversity analysis
  • Integration with downstream stats and visualization tools
  • Real-world use: Analyze a microbiome dataset by computing alpha/beta diversity and ordinating results for interpretation.
